Understanding ESG Frameworks and Risk Assessment Methodologies

One of the core components of the program is the exploration of ESG frameworks. Participants will learn about various frameworks such as the Global Reporting Initiative (GRI), Sustainability Accounting Standards Board (SASB), and Task Force on Climate-related Financial Disclosures (TCFD). These frameworks provide a structured approach to understanding and reporting on ESG factors, which are increasingly important in financial risk assessment.

Risk assessment methodologies are another crucial aspect of the program. Participants will be introduced to a range of tools and techniques that help in identifying, quantifying, and mitigating ESG-related risks. This includes scenario analysis, stress testing, and risk mapping. These methodologies are essential for understanding the potential impacts of ESG factors on financial performance and for developing effective risk management strategies.
